TN SB 777

died on adjournment

Election Laws - As introduced, specifies that the reasonable period for candidates to remove signs, posters, or placards advocating their candidacy is two weeks after the election instead of three weeks. - Amends TCA Title 2.

Did TN SB 777 pass?

No. TN SB 777 died when the 114S1 session adjourned without final action on it. Bills that die this way are sometimes reintroduced in a later session. Latest recorded action (2026-04-24): Sponsor(s) Added.
